Tharun Bhascker speaks out on Keedaa Cola AI issue

The filmmaker was sued by SP Charan for recreating the voice of SP Balasubramanyam for a song in the former's film Keedaa Cola

CE Features

We had previously reported that the makers of Keedaa Cola had been on the receiving end of a legal notice issued by singer and producer SP Charan for the AI recreation of SP Balasubramanyam’s voice. Tharun Bhascker, the producer and director of Keedaa Cola, had recently spoken about the issue at the trailer launch of the ETV Win Original series Thulasivanam. Thulasivanam, starring Akshay Lagusani and Venkatesh Kakumanu, is produced by Tharun Bhascker’s home banner VG Sainma. 

Tharun had rubbished off speculations on a feud between himself and SP Charan by stating that what they have had so far was merely a communication issue. The filmmaker had also reiterated that the AI recreation of SP Balasubramanyam’s voice came from a place of respect. He mentions that the song was a way of honoring SPB’s legacy and did not have any malafide, ‘commercial’ intentions attached to it whatsoever. 

Speaking about artificial intelligence, the director reflected that while an evolution in technologies poses a threat to jobs all over, one must, nevertheless, move ahead with the times. 

Keedaa Cola starred Chaitanya Rao, Rag Mayur, Brahmanandam, Jeevan Reddy, Vishnu Oi, Tharun Bhascker, Ravindra Vijay and Raghu Ram. The film had music composed by Tharun’s frequent collaborator Vivek Sagar.
